Ms Mary Harney:

Well, one would have to say in hindsight, notwithstanding the changes we made, with the exception of the consumer issues, where I think the new regulator did have a very proactive, hands-on approach to the consumer issues, because prior to that the Central Bank, I think, referred issues around bank charges to the director of consumer affairs - it wasn't an area that they had an interest in - but notwithstanding the changes it's fair to say that I think the culture didn't change.
